Output 3037946d4232db9a9f29e276e3a9492623b5770a7840c82a92bc3b0d02c4e9f3:0

value
104900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 101f621bb5e39f622873870a5019e71231a6a6c4 OP_EQUAL
address
33AGLA9JrGT4rstG8ysgsZmEDVkfgZ7wkc
transaction
3037946d4232db9a9f29e276e3a9492623b5770a7840c82a92bc3b0d02c4e9f3
spent
true